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Bakers, is another h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 86.5°F (30.3°C) and 67.3°F (19.6°C).

Temperature

With August's advent, Bakers, Kentucky, sees an average high-temperature of a still hot 86.5°F (30.3°C), subtly shifted from July's 87.6°F (30.9°C). An average minimum temperature of 67.3°F (19.6°C) is recorded in Bakers during the month of August.

Heat index

August's average heat index is calculated to be a sweltering 98.6°F (37°C). Incorporate additional preventive steps,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are possible.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.
Regarding the heat index, one should be aware it's determined by shaded settings and mild winds. If directly exposed to the sun, the heat index could r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', is calculated by taking the relative humidity value for a specific location and factoring it into the air temperature reading. One's perception of temperature can vary depending on physical activity and individual heat sensitivity,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Understand that direct sun rays can influence the weather's impact, le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Young children are more at risk than adults since they tend to sweat less. Moreover, their large skin surface in proportion to their small bodies and the high heat production due to their activities contribute to their vulnerability.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ration. Excessive warmth is eliminated from the body by evaporation of sweat. Excessive relative humidity disturbs the body's typical cooling process by reducing evaporation, leading to a decrease in body cooling rate and an increase in the sensation of warmth. Heat-related disorders may develop if heat gain in the body overshadows its cooling capacity, leading to elevated temperatures.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ity in Bakers is 76%.

Rainfall

In Bakers, during August, the rain falls for 13.7 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.28" (58m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 145 rainfall days, and 26.93" (684m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

May through October are months without snowfall.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day in Bakers is 13h and 32min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:57 am and sunset at 7:59 pm. On the last day of August, in Bakers, sunrise is at 6:22 am and sunset at 7:21 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In August, the average sunshine in Bakers is 10.3h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: In August, the maximum UV index of 6 translates into these guidelines:
Sidestep overexposure. Individuals with fair complexions risk burning in fewer than 20 minutes. Stay in the shade and limit dire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its strongest. Remember, however, that not all shade structures provide full sun protection. Counter UV radiation's ill effects with clothing designed for sun safety and UV-resistant eyewear.
